Subject: Log sampling rollout for chirpd

Hey all — quick heads-up for anyone new (welcome!). The chirpd service on the Bramblegate cluster has been flooding our log sink, so we're enabling 1-in-50 sampling for INFO lines starting with tomorrow's release. Errors and warnings are never sampled, so don't panic if your grep counts drop. If you need full-fidelity logs for debugging, flip the override flag in the service config. The release carrying this change is identified by the token just below.

pipeline stamp: htk6_4eec0d

## Formula sandbox tuning

User-supplied formulas in Gridmoor execute inside a restricted interpreter with hard ceilings on time, memory, and call depth. Reviewers should confirm any change to these ceilings is justified in the PR description, since raising them widens the abuse surface. Defaults were chosen from production traces. The current limits are as follows.

limits module of tafog-fawip:
WEIGHTS = {
    "julix": 57,
    "lamys": 992,
    "kasvan": 209,
    "quenok": 750,
    "alddor": 259,
    "oliath": 1009,
    "wenix": 815,
}

## Key Ceremony — Gatekiln Rate Limiter

- [ ] Rotate signing keys for Gatekiln, the internal API gateway. Rate-limit counters reset during rotation; expect brief 429 noise on Fennick services.
- [ ] Two custodians present, witnessed by ops lead.
- [ ] Verify quota configs reload post-rotation.
- [ ] Seal the recovery envelope. For the sync record, the ceremony passphrase is recorded below.

strongbox words: zorath-holmir